final
final
在程序设计中,我们有时可能希望某些数据是不能够改变的,这个时候final就有用武之地了。final是java的关键字,本文就详细说明一下他的使用方法
在本篇文章里小编给大家分享的是关于java关键字final用法知识点以及相关实例内容,有需要的朋友们可以学习下。
标签: jvm
含义最终的,不可改变的。常见四大用法: 修饰类 修饰方法 修饰成员变量 修饰局部变量
先将父类放入方法区,再将子类放入方法区,父类中存在static,先进行输出,随后输出子类中的static 然后执行子类中的main方法,new Test()不仅...多态:子类对象可以使用父类对象的方法。程序中存在static的输出顺序。
final是Java中的修饰符关键字,用于修饰变量、类、方法。1、当某个变量不允许修改数据值时,可以用final修饰变量。2、当某个方法不允许被子类重写时,可以用final修饰方法。3、当某个类不允许被继承时,可以用final...
标签: java
final关键字代表最终,不可改变的,常见四种用法: 1:可以用来修饰一个类; 2:可以用来修饰一个方法; 3:可以用来修饰一个局部变量; 4:可以用来修饰一个成员变量。 1:可以用来修饰一个类; /* 当final关键字...
JAVA
C++ final用法简介
??
标签: java
final关键字的用法非常多,它可以修饰类,可以修饰方法,可以修饰变量,可以修饰基本数据类型,也可以修饰引用数据类型,接下来我们就自己分析它的用法。
标签: c++
final作用于类名之后,表示这个类不能被继承。
在 Java 语言中提供了多个作用域修饰符,其中常用的有 public、private、protected、final、abstract、static、transient 和 volatile,这些修饰符有类修饰符、变量修饰符和方法修饰符。
从语义上理解最后一次,即被修饰的只能“赋值”一次。
标签: java
本文为大家分享了java中final修饰符的使用,供大家参考,具体内容如下1.final修饰符的用法:final可以修饰变量,被final修饰的变量被赋初始值之后,不能对它重新赋值。final可以修饰方法,被final修饰的方法不能被...
引用数据类型的常量不允许重新分配内存地址。2.用于声明方法(最终方法),该方法在了类中不能重写,在当前类中允许重载。1.用于声明常量:基本数据类型的常量不允许修改值,3.用于声明类(最终类), 该类不允许子类继承。
标签: final
总的来说,`final` 的作用是创建不可变的实体,可以是变量、类、方法或参数。在面向对象编程中,`final` 可用于类的声明,表示该类不能被继承。在继承中,`final` 可以用于方法声明,表示该方法不能被子类覆盖或重写...
Java中static、this、super、final用法.docx
注意:常量名的命名规范:建议使用大写英文单词,多个单词使用下划线连接起来。static final修饰的成员变量就称为常量。通常用于记录系统的配置信息。
1.final关键字 1.1.final关键字修饰变量 (1)类加载时执行顺序 static代码块>代码块>...1.2.final关键字修饰方法 (1)表明该方法不能被子类重写,防止类修改他的含义 (2)与static比较
本文将为大家介绍Java中static、this、super、final用法。
标签: java
java中final
static 用法static修饰变量按照是否静态的对类成员变量进行分类可分两种:一种是被static修饰的变量,叫静态变量或类变量;另一种是没有被static修饰的变量,叫实例变量。 区别是:对于静态变量在内存中只有一个...
3)非静态成员变量在构造方法中赋值。三种赋值方式的顺序是1)、2)、3),若有一种方式先行赋值了,则后面的方式就不能再赋值,否则就会编译错误。public class FinalTest {private final int a;...
private Single final SINGLE_INSTANCE = new Single(); Single() {} public Single get_Instance() { return SINGLE_INSTANCE; } } 饿汉式单例程最好是加上final关键字,确保第一次创建的对象的永远不变。...
Java中的final关键字可以被用来修饰变量、方法和类等,意味着终结、不可改变,下面我们就来举例讲解Java中final关键字的用法: